About this skill
Use things to read your local Things database (inbox/today/search/projects/areas/tags) and to add/update todos via the Things URL scheme. Setup Read-only (DB) Write (URL scheme) Examples: add a todo Examples: modify a todo (needs auth token) Delete a todo? Notes - Install (recommended, Apple Silicon): GOBIN=/opt/homebrew/bin go install github.com/ossianhempel/things3-cli/cmd/things@latest - If DB reads fail: grant Full Disk Access to the calling app (Terminal for manual runs; OpenClaw.app for gateway runs). - Optional: set THINGSDB (or pass --db ) to point at your ThingsData-* folder. - Optional: set THINGS_AUTH_TOKEN to avoid passing --auth-token for update ops. - things inbox --limit 50 - things today - things upcoming - things search "query" - things projects / things areas / things tags - Prefer safe preview: things --dry-run add "Title" - Add: things add "Title" --notes "..." --when today --deadline 2026-01-02 - Bring Things to front: things --foreground add "Title" - Basic: things add "Buy milk" - With notes: things add "Buy milk" --notes "2% + bananas" - Into a project/area: things add "Book flights" --list "Travel" - Into a project heading: things add "Pack charger" --list "Travel" --heading "Before" - With tags: things add "Call dentist" --tags "health,phone" - Checklist: things add "Trip prep" --checklist-item "Passport" --checklist-item "Tickets" - From STDIN...
